Q16.

Quadrant II is (- , +)

I choose the point (-1, 1) and the slope 1.

Substitute point and slope into the formula to find b.

y = mx + b

1 = (1)(-1) + b

b = 2

The equation is y = x + 2

Q15.

The slope is represented by the m value in y=mx+b. Choose a random negative value for m. I will make b 0 so I don't need to write it.

y= -x (slope is negative 1)

Q14.

m = 5; (-6,1)

Sub m and point into y=mx+b; isolate for b.

y=mx+b

1=5(-6)+b

1 = -30 + b

b = 31

Sub b=31 and m=5 into equation of a line

The equation is y = 5x + 31

Q12.

Find slope between (5,2) and (6,4)

m = (y2-y1)/(x2-x1) = (4-2)/(6-5) = 2/1 = 2

Find b by substituting slope and point (5,2) into equation of a line

y=mx+b

2 = 2(5) + b

2 = 10 + b

b = -8

Sub b= -8 and m=2 to find equation

The equation of the line is y=2x-8

Q11.

Sub m= -4 and point (5,9) into the equation of a line, isolate b

y=mx+b

9 = -4(5) + b

9 = -20 + b

b = 29

Sub b=29 and m= -4 into the equation of a line

The equation of a line is y = -4x + 29
